SELF names healthiest places for women


SELF, a national women’s well-being magazine, announces Burlington, Vt., as the nation’s healthiest city in the 10th annual Healthiest Places For Women survey. The results will be in the November issue.
Analyzing the 100 largest U.S. metropolitan areas, SELF’s examination is the most comprehensive of its kind. Distinguished for its broad scope of research criteria, more than 8,000 bits of data were evaluated to determine each city’s level of healthy living.
SELF polled experts to find out which factors most affect a woman’s ability to live her healthiest. Then a list was compiled of 50 criteria, including rates of diseases such as cancer and depression; factors that affect access to health care: the number of doctors per capita and the percentage of each area’s population covered by insurance; environmental and community measures: air quality, crime rates and unemployment statistics; and habits such as exercise, diet and smoking.
